Step 4: Charging
Now that you have connected the iPhone charger to the PS4 controller, the charging process will begin automatically. You can verify the charging status by checking the light bar on the controller. The light bar will begin to flash, indicating that the controller is being charged. Once the battery is fully charged, the light bar will stop flashing and remain solid.

Q1: Can I use any iPhone charger to charge my PS4 controller?
A1: Most iPhone chargers should work, as long as they have a USB connection and support the required power output. However, it is recommended to use an official Apple charger or a charger from a reputable third-party brand to ensure compatibility and safety.
Q2: Can I charge my PS4 controller while playing?
A2: Yes, you can charge your PS4 controller while playing. The charging process does not interfere with gameplay, allowing you to enjoy uninterrupted gaming sessions.
Q3: How long does it take to charge a PS4 controller with an iPhone charger?
A3: The time required to charge a PS4 controller with an iPhone charger may vary depending on the battery level and the charger’s power output. On average, it takes around 2 to 3 hours to fully charge a PS4 controller.
